Super-resolution imaging and estimation of protein copy numbers at single synapses with DNA-point accumulation for imaging in nanoscale topography
In the brain, the strength of each individual synapse is defined by the complement of proteins present or the “local proteome.” Activity-dependent changes in synaptic strength are the result of changes in this local proteome and posttranslational protein modifications.
